七、for+else else也是在for循环正常结束的情况下才会执行 for i in range(10): if i == 3: break print(i) else: print(123) 七、for循环的嵌套使用 for i in range(3): for j in range(5): print("*=", end='') print() # print代表换行 for i in range(1, 10): for j in range(...
for sum in range(1,100,2): num = num + sum print(num) 1. 2. 3. 4. 需求3:用户输入一个数字,求该数的阶乘:3!=321 num = int(input('请输入一个数字:')) res = 1 for i in range(1,num+1): res *= i print('%s的阶乘是%d' %(num,res)) 1. 2. 3. 4. 5. 操作练习: 用...
1、示例代码 for i in range(0, 11):print(i)2、示例结果 0 1 2 3 4 5 6 7 8 9 10
方法/步骤 1 for的格式是什么样子的呢?标准的for如下图 2 我们注意到这个例子上面的循环是一个列表,但这个并不能让我们直接获得1-10的循环 3 直接输入次数10的话,这里显示的是错误的 4 其实想法是对的,但差了一个函数,range下面我们用range之后尝试一下但结果是0,1,2 5 也就是说range(3) 依次会输出0,...
for循环:用于遍历序列(如列表、元组、字典、集合或字符串)或其他可迭代对象。 pythonforiin range(10): # 这将循环10次,i的值从0到9print(i) while循环:当给定条件为真时,重复执行代码块。 pythoni=0while i <10:# 这将循环10次 print(i) i += 1 ...
print("计算 0+2+...+10 的结果为:")保存累加结果的变量result = 0 逐个获取从 0到 10 这些值,并做累加操作 for i in range(0,10):result += iprint(result)上面代码中,使用了 range() 函数,此函数是 Python 内置函数,用于生成一系列连续整数,多用于 for 循环中。
for i in range(10) 这个代码是循环10次的,是从 0 开始,到10-1=9结束,不包括10的。相关知识补充说明:函数语法:range(stop)range(start, stop[, step])参数说明:start: 计数从 start 开始。默认是从 0 开始。例如range(5)等价于range(0, 5);stop: 计数到 stop 结束,但不包括 stop。例如...
一、for 循环本质遍历序列 for 循环 中 , 语法如下 : 代码语言:javascript 复制 for临时变量in数据集:循环操作 上述语法中的 数据集 是 序列类型 , 该类型变量 用于存储一系列有序的元素 , 常见的序列类型有 : 字符串 String 列表List 元组Tuple
[expression for iter_val in iterable if cond_expr] 实例展示: 1 要求:列出1~10所有数字的平方2###3 1、普通方法: 4 >>> L =[ ] 5 >>>for iin range(1,11): 6 ... L.append(i**2) 7... 8 >>>printL9 [1, 4, 9, 16, 25...